
在DataGrip中创建数据库的方法包括:使用数据库管理工具、执行SQL脚本、通过UI界面进行手动创建。其中,使用数据库管理工具是最为便捷和高效的方法。DataGrip是JetBrains开发的一款强大的数据库管理工具,支持多种数据库类型,如MySQL、PostgreSQL、SQL Server等。接下来,我将详细介绍如何在DataGrip中创建数据库,并探讨在实际使用中的一些专业技巧和注意事项。
一、安装与配置DataGrip
1、下载和安装
首先,您需要从JetBrains官网(https://www.jetbrains.com/datagrip/)下载DataGrip的安装包。根据您的操作系统选择合适的版本,然后按照提示完成安装过程。安装完成后,启动DataGrip并完成初始配置。
2、配置数据库连接
在使用DataGrip创建数据库之前,您需要配置与数据库服务器的连接。
- 新建连接:在DataGrip界面左侧的Database工具窗口中,点击“+”号,选择“Data Source”,然后选择您要连接的数据库类型。
- 输入连接信息:填写数据库服务器的主机名、端口号、用户名和密码等信息。点击“Test Connection”按钮测试连接是否成功。如果一切正常,点击“OK”保存配置。
二、通过DataGrip创建数据库
1、使用SQL脚本创建数据库
最常见的方法是通过SQL脚本来创建数据库。以下是一个简单的示例脚本,用于创建MySQL数据库:
CREATE DATABASE my_database;
在DataGrip中,您可以通过以下步骤执行该脚本:
- 新建SQL文件:在Database工具窗口中,右键点击您的数据库连接,选择“New”->“SQL File”。
- 编写SQL脚本:在新建的SQL文件中输入上述脚本。
- 执行脚本:点击SQL编辑器上方的“Run”按钮或按下快捷键(Ctrl+Enter),执行脚本。
2、通过UI界面手动创建数据库
DataGrip也提供了通过图形界面手动创建数据库的功能。
- 打开Database工具窗口:在DataGrip左侧的Database工具窗口中,右键点击您的数据库连接,选择“New”->“Database”。
- 填写数据库信息:在弹出的对话框中,输入要创建的数据库名称等必要信息。
- 确认创建:点击“OK”按钮,完成数据库创建过程。
三、优化与管理数据库
1、使用索引提升查询性能
创建数据库后,接下来要关注的是如何优化数据库性能。一个常见的做法是为经常查询的表创建索引。以下是一个示例SQL,用于在名为users的表上创建索引:
CREATE INDEX idx_users_name ON users (name);
通过索引,可以大大提升查询速度,特别是在数据量较大的情况下。
2、定期备份与恢复
为了确保数据安全,定期备份数据库是非常必要的。DataGrip提供了备份和恢复功能,您可以通过右键点击数据库连接,选择“Tools”->“Backup/Restore”进行操作。
3、监控数据库性能
DataGrip还提供了一些监控工具,可以帮助您实时监控数据库的性能。通过这些工具,您可以查看当前的连接数、查询执行时间等指标,及时发现并解决潜在的问题。
四、使用项目管理系统提升团队协作
在团队开发中,使用项目管理系统可以大大提升协作效率。这里推荐两款项目管理系统:研发项目管理系统PingCode和通用项目协作软件Worktile。
1、PingCode
PingCode是一款专为研发团队设计的项目管理系统,支持需求管理、任务管理、缺陷管理等功能。通过PingCode,团队成员可以清晰地了解项目进度、分配任务和跟踪问题,提升团队协作效率。
2、Worktile
Worktile是一款通用项目协作软件,适用于各类团队。它提供了任务管理、文档协作、团队沟通等功能,通过Worktile,团队成员可以高效地协作和沟通,确保项目按时交付。
五、常见问题与解决方案
1、无法连接数据库
如果您在配置数据库连接时遇到问题,首先检查网络连接是否正常,然后确认您输入的连接信息(如主机名、端口号、用户名和密码)是否正确。如果仍然无法解决问题,可以尝试使用数据库服务器的命令行工具连接数据库,以确认问题是否出在DataGrip上。
2、SQL脚本执行失败
在执行SQL脚本时,如果遇到错误,首先检查脚本语法是否正确。如果语法正确,但仍然执行失败,可以查看数据库服务器的日志文件,获取更多错误信息。
3、性能问题
如果您的数据库性能不佳,可以尝试以下几种方法进行优化:
- 优化查询:检查慢查询,优化SQL语句。
- 增加索引:为经常查询的字段增加索引。
- 分区表:将大表进行分区,提升查询性能。
六、结语
通过本文的介绍,您应该已经了解了如何在DataGrip中创建数据库,并掌握了一些优化和管理数据库的技巧。DataGrip作为一款功能强大的数据库管理工具,不仅支持多种数据库类型,还提供了丰富的功能,帮助您高效地进行数据库管理和开发。在团队协作方面,使用项目管理系统如PingCode和Worktile,可以大大提升团队的协作效率,确保项目按时交付。希望本文对您有所帮助,祝您在数据库管理和开发中取得更大的成功。
相关问答FAQs:
1. 如何在Datagrip中创建一个新的数据库?
在Datagrip中创建数据库非常简单。只需按照以下步骤操作:
- 打开Datagrip,连接到数据库服务器。
- 在导航窗格中,右键单击“数据库”文件夹,然后选择“新建”>“数据库”。
- 在弹出的对话框中,输入数据库的名称和其他相关信息(如字符集和排序规则)。
- 点击“确定”按钮,即可成功创建一个新的数据库。
2. Datagrip中如何导入一个现有的数据库?
如果你已经有一个现有的数据库,你可以通过以下步骤在Datagrip中导入它:
- 打开Datagrip,连接到数据库服务器。
- 在导航窗格中,右键单击“数据库”文件夹,然后选择“导入”>“数据库”。
- 在弹出的对话框中,选择要导入的数据库文件的位置(例如.sql文件)。
- 点击“确定”按钮,Datagrip将开始导入数据库。
3. 如何在Datagrip中删除一个数据库?
要删除一个数据库,只需按照以下步骤操作:
- 打开Datagrip,连接到数据库服务器。
- 在导航窗格中,找到要删除的数据库。
- 右键单击数据库,然后选择“删除”。
- 在弹出的对话框中,确认删除操作。
请注意,删除数据库是一个不可逆的操作,请谨慎使用。确保在删除之前备份你的数据。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1727076